简单的触发器例子

create trigger insertMemberMoney

on MemberMoney

after INSERT
AS
DECLARE @moneyType INT
DECLARE @money decimal
SELECT @moneyType=MoneyType,@money=[money] FROM INSERTED
 

IF @moneyType=3  --充值成功
BEGIN
    update member

set RechargeAccount=RechargeAccount+@money,TempRechargeAccount =

TempRechargeAccount+@money

where id=(select memberid from inserted)

END
ELSE IF @moneyType=4  --返奖
BEGIN
    --todo
set
    
where id=(select memberid from inserted)
END



posted on 2010-02-11 10:55  银翼幻影  阅读(101)  评论(0)    收藏  举报

导航